AI Summary
- Honors the Caroline Scott Harrison Memorial Sculpture Committee on Caroline Scott Harrison Day, October 5, 2014
- Recognizes the committee's dedication to promoting Caroline Scott Harrison, wife of the 23rd U.S. president, accomplished artist, and first president general of the Daughters of the American Revolution
- Acknowledges the committee's efforts to recognize Caroline Scott Harrison's connection to Oxford, Ohio, where she was born and educated, and her husband Benjamin Harrison's 1852 graduation from Miami University
- Commends committee members for their foresight, dedication, and charitable contributions to the Oxford community
- Directs the Senate Clerk to transmit an authenticated copy of the resolution to the Caroline Scott Harrison Memorial Sculpture Committee
